A Colombian court recently heard the case of Aida Victoria Merlano, a 21-year-old popular female model in the country's self-media, who was suspected of planning and assisting her mother in successfully escaping from prison. If found guilty, the beauty, who has more than 2.5 million followers, faces 21 years in prison.
Ada, a popular 21-year-old female model on social media Instagram, was reportedly accused of planning and assisting her 38-year-old mother, Aida Merlano Rebolledo, from Bogotá prison in October 2019.
At the time, Repolldo was a senator, but six months after winning the election, authorities discovered that she had hidden weapons, defrauded voters and other evidence of corruption, for which Repoledo was sentenced to 15 years in prison.

Merano's 38-year-old mother, Repollerdo, was a former senator.
Just two weeks later, Repollerdo managed to escape from prison. Surveillance footage shows that while her daughter Merano was distracted from her dental clinic outside Repollado prison, repool took the opportunity to slide a rope from the second-floor window of the clinic, jump on the back seat of a man's bicycle, and flee the scene.
A month later, the naked Merano was on the cover of a magazine, handcuffed, with the headline: "Daughter of a fleeing congresswoman confesses guilt." ”
Colombian authorities did not capture Repolldo in Venezuela until January 2020.
Prosecutors suspected Merano and the dentist of being accomplices in Repoller's escape from prison and filed the case.
The two pleaded not guilty, but if found guilty, Merano faces 21 years in prison.
